Carseldine Green's Wellness Centre opens its doors
12th November 2021 | 3 min read
Our new Wellness Centre at Carseldine Greens Care Community officially opened its doors last week, welcoming all who wish to participate in our wellness program.
Jeremy, who has worked with a number of our residents before, has joined us as the principal physiotherapist from Healthcare Australia (HCA). We are all excited to welcome Jeremy and his team back to our Care Community to lead our wellness program here.
We have hit the ground running and the HCA team have already seen 20 of our residents over the past week for an initial assessment. Our residents are enjoying setting their goals and exploring the different equipment that is available to them. We also have families who have expressed interest in having their loved ones try out our Wellness Centre. Each wellness program is tailored to suit the needs and interests of each resident or client.
Jean, the loving wife of Robin who resides in our Memory Care Neighbourhood says, “I know that the physical activity will be great for my husband, and being in the company of Jeremy is another added benefit given he is such a gentleman.”
Our Wellness Centres focus on delivering personalised reablement and restoration programs to support the long-term health and happiness of our elders. To date, we have opened 18 Wellness Centres across 4 states with plans to open up more in the new year.
